Kristin Mary Jacobi (born 16 October 1931) is a former competitive swimmer from New Zealand.

Swimming career

At the 1950 British Empire Games held in Auckland, she won the silver medal as part of the women's 440 yard freestyle relay. Her teammates in the relay were Norma Bridson, Winifred Griffin and Joan Hastings.[http://www.commonwealthgames.org.nz/Athletes/AthleteProfile.aspx?print=&id=0&ContactID=26864 Profile at the New Zealand Olympic Committee] Jacobi also recorded a 12th place finish in the 110 yard freestyle.
